Antigua,a beach for every day of the year!

Having been a travel agent for over 30 years, I have to admit I have never visited Antigua. It was therefore with excitement that I boarded the Virgin flight on the 24th March heading for a 7 day inspection trip to Antigua.

They say that Antigua has a beach for every day of the year and in all my travels I have never seen such beautiful, pristine beaches and to my surprise many of which, were deserted. Besides the crystal clear, azure seas and pink sands this small island has much more to offer.

We visited hotels ranging from good value, family 3* all inclusive to the exclusive resort of Jumby Bay on Long Island, so an island for all budgets and tastes.

For the history buffs a visit to Nelsons ‘Dockyard is a must and a stay overnight at the Copper & Lumber Store Hotel, an unique 18th Century restored property boasting many authentic antiques and period pieces. For adventure seekers try the zip line experience through the rainforest canopy or swim with stingrays (I don't think that I have ever laughed so much!) and for seclusion a trip to Barbuda and the Frigate bird sanctuary.

Culinary delights are offered at all the top hotels but if you want to experience the pure magic and friendliness of this island then a trip to Shirley Heights on a Sunday is highly recommended with spectacular views over English Harbour, a great BBQ and wonderful atmosphere.
